What are fossil fuels primarily formed from?

Remains of ancient organisms

What percentage of U.S. greenhouse gas emissions are from the transportation sector?

29%

Which of the following is a non-renewable energy source?

Fossil fuels

What is the main environmental impact of burning fossil fuels for transportation?

Release of greenhouse gases

Based on the information provided, which mode of transportation likely has the lowest emissions?

Electric vehicles

What is the primary purpose of the 'CO2 Energy Emissions' chart?

To compare emissions from different energy sources

What does the term 'non-renewable' mean in the context of energy sources?

The energy source cannot be replenished naturally within a reasonable timeframe
